Something for the kids - Bjössaróló in Borgarnes

Bjössarólo was built by idealist Björn H Guðmundsson (Bjössi), a master carpanter who lived in Borgarnes. He began constructing the playground in 1979 and maintained it himself, continually adding to it until he was well into his seventies. He built the whole playground from items that had been thrown out or were to be discarded and it’s a great place to visit with your kids.
